What Is Conversation Intelligence Software?

Conversation Intelligence Software analyzes customer and sales conversations from recordings, transcripts, and meeting data to surface what happened, why it happened, and what to do next. It reduces manual call review by generating AI call summaries and key-moment highlights, then it supports structured coaching and quality workflows using conversation evidence. Revenue teams use it to connect talk tracks and objections to pipeline outcomes, while service teams use it to detect themes, intent, and risk patterns in customer interactions. Tools like Gong show AI-generated call summaries and moment detection for revenue coaching, while Genesys Conversation Insights brings governed conversation analytics into the Genesys customer engagement stack.

Key Features to Look For

These capabilities determine whether a Conversation Intelligence tool drives coaching and execution or stays limited to transcription and one-time summaries.

  • AI call summaries and key-moment detection with coaching signals

    Look for AI-generated call summaries and moment detection that jump from long transcripts to specific moments that matter for coaching. Gong excels at AI call summaries and in-context coaching insights, and Observe.AI flags key moments tied to negotiation, objections, and compliance-relevant segments.

  • Conversation analytics dashboards mapped to outcomes and themes

    Choose tools that turn transcripts into measurable discussion themes and track how conversations progress toward outcomes. Klant provides dashboards that map transcripts to coaching-ready themes and outcomes, and Medallia connects conversation findings to broader experience and journey analytics.

  • Objection, risk, and compliance-relevant transcript detection

    Effective platforms detect risks like missed objections and stalled deal language or compliance-relevant segments so managers can coach faster. Gong and Observe.AI both focus on surfacing objections and risk patterns inside transcript content, while Clari highlights deal risks from conversation signals.

  • Quality scoring and QA automation for repeatable coaching

    If you run QA across many agents or sellers, prioritize AI-assisted scoring and repeatable QA workflows. Talkdesk delivers AI-driven QA automation with speech and conversation analytics tied to agent and queue performance, and Genesys Conversation Insights includes built-in quality scoring with coaching-ready insights.

  • Workflow routing for flagged calls and coaching review cycles

    Select tools that can route flagged conversations into review queues so teams can act on issues consistently. Katch supports workflow-style review routing for conversation evidence, and Gong uses conversation intelligence to surface moments and insights that support coaching workflows.

  • CRM and sales execution alignment to next steps

    For revenue teams, the highest impact comes when conversation signals translate into CRM actions and next steps. Clari ties conversation insights to revenue execution workflows and deal risk scoring inside CRM process automation, and Zoom IQ for Sales brings conversation analytics into the Zoom Meetings workflow for actionable coaching views.

Common Mistakes to Avoid

These pitfalls show up across tools when organizations choose the wrong workflow fit or underestimate configuration and governance effort.

  • Assuming transcription-only analysis will satisfy coaching and QA needs

    If you only need basic transcription, Klant and Observe.AI can feel less compelling because both emphasize structured analytics, coaching workflows, and evidence-based insights beyond transcription. Gong, Zoom IQ for Sales, and Talkdesk are built around coaching signals and QA automation outputs rather than transcript dumping.

  • Underestimating setup effort for tagging, permissions, and workflow configuration

    Gong setup takes time because tagging, permissions, and data mapping matter for correct coaching context. Clari also requires time for workflow configuration across teams, and Genesys Conversation Insights adds complexity when governance and custom models are required.

  • Expecting advanced insights without clean call capture and CRM hygiene

    Clari’s deep insights depend on clean CRM hygiene and consistent call capture, so inconsistent CRM data reduces the usefulness of deal risk scoring. Observe.AI also relies heavily on clean integrations and consistent recording, so gaps in capture reduce transcript-based insights.

  • Choosing a multi-channel enterprise suite when the primary need is structured voice QA automation

    Medallia and Genesys Conversation Insights align best when you need governed experience or CX stack reporting across broader programs. Talkdesk is more aligned to enterprise contact centers because its QA automation and speech analytics focus on voice interactions tied to queues and agents.
